The Opportunity

  • Take your career to the next level within an incredible team!
  • Inform business decision-making through data driven insight
  • Lead market analysis projects working alongside science teams at CSIRO

 

As the Market Analyst you will play an important role in providing enterprise level market intelligence support to various groups across CSIRO.

 

You will play a vital role, providing high quality market, industry, customer and competitive analysis and insights; and drawing conclusions that will inform business decision-making in relation to the market landscape, as well as providing information to help align key research areas with industry.

 

This is a genuinely meaningful role which will support researchers’ decision-making processes about future commercial pathways for their research and technology.  

 

While demonstrating proficiency working autonomously, you will sit alongside great people and market analysts within the Business Engagement Solutions Team (BEST) which reports into the Strategic Delivery Business Unit, CSIRO Growth.

 

Your duties will include:

  • Leading market analysis projects by working alongside science teams to source, evaluate, synthesise and analyse a broad range of qualitative and quantitative data.

  • Forming insights, providing written business reports and analysis that can be included as input to decision-making about research & technology pathways.

  • Providing support to the Commercialisation team through market scoping.

  • Managing stakeholder engagement, presenting results to internal teams and workshops, facilitating market-related discussions.

  • Contributing to a team environment that values equity and diversity and enables the achievement of personal objectives, team and organisational KPIs, including adhering to the spirit and practice of CSIRO’s values, HSE policies and diversity initiatives.

  • Other duties and tasks that may arise as priorities for the team and for Growth.

 

The work is based around secondary desktop research and does not require the applicant to source primary data or undertake field trips to perform the role.

 

Location: CSIRO Sites in all AU Major Cities will be considered. A hybrid working environment is available.

Salary: AU $105,806 - $114,500 plus up to 15.4% superannuation

Tenure: Specified term until 20 December 2024

Reference: 95990

 

To be considered you will need:

  • Tertiary or PhD qualification\s in science, business & commerce and\or relevant experience in technology commercialisation.

  • Demonstrated proficiency in report writing, presentation and communication.

  • Demonstrated skills and understanding of data retrieval techniques and market analysis.

  • Interest in markets, business, science trends and innovation.

  • An MBA and previous experience with market analysis databases is desirable.

  • We are preferably looking for someone with a scientific background and broad interest across many science disciplines, combined with a high level of business & commercial acumen.
